Q: Is 323,004,311 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 323,004,311 is a composite number.

Why is 323,004,311 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 323,004,311 can be evenly divided by 1 7 1,913 13,391 24,121 168,847 46,143,473 and 323,004,311, with no remainder.

Since 323,004,311 cannot be divided by just 1 and 323,004,311, it is a composite number.
